[РЕШЕНО] Nvidia+Xorg: No devices detected.
Здравствуйте уважаемые форумчане!
Появилась одна проблема.
Gentoo поставил с дисков OSmarket 27 февраля.
А тут на днях обновился и все X'сы больше не стартуют.
До этого стояло: udev-138, vanilla-sources-2.6.29.2, nvidia-drivers-173.14.16, xorg-server-1.5.3-r4.
После обновления стало: udev-141, gentoo-sources-2.6.29-r4, nvidia-drivers-173.14.18, xorg-server-1.5.3-r6.
Сразу после перезагрузки исчезло устройство /dev/nvidiactl.
На сайте http://wiki.x.org нашел скрипт:
for i in 0 1 2 3 4 5 6 7; do
node="/dev/nvidia$i"
rm -f $node
mknod $node c 195 $i || echo "mknod \"$node\""
chmod 0660 $node || echo "chmod \"$node\""
chown :video $node || echo "chown \"$node\""
done
node="/dev/nvidiactl"
rm -f $node
mknod $node c 195 255 || echo "mknod \"$node\""
chmod 0666 $node || echo "chmod \"$node\""
chown :video $node || echo "chown \"$node\""
Непомог скрипт :(
modprobe nvidia & dmesg - показывают что всё нормально и ошибок нет.
так же исчезла директория /proc/pci!
И до этого была проблема с выключением компа: когда он должен уже выключится, то пишет следующие INIT: no more process in this run level!
Поэтому надеюсь на вашу помощь!
Привожу логи nvidia-bug-report.sh:
krigstask: для приведения надо почитать FAQ
- Для комментирования войдите или зарегистрируйтесь
А почему nvidia-drivers такие
А почему nvidia-drivers такие старенькие? Они могут с .29 ядром не дружить.
Текстовый редактор vi имеет два режима работы: в первом он пищит, а во втором — всё портит.
krigstask написал(а):А почему
старенькие? другие выше 173.* не работают и выдают device not found (Видюха у меня GeForce 5200FX).
А 173.14.16 я юзал как раз таки на ядре 2.6.29.2!
>:]
Я уже сообразил, ага (-:Е А
Я уже сообразил, ага (-:Е
А всякие etc-update или dispatch-conf производились?
Текстовый редактор vi имеет два режима работы: в первом он пищит, а во втором — всё портит.
конечно
конечно
>:]
Привожу логи
Привожу логи nvidia-bug-report.sh:
http://paste.org.ru/?v2et4s
>:]
h1z написал(а):Привожу логи
Спасибо то самое.
evadim: забанен за спам
У кого нибудь есть идеи по
У кого нибудь есть идеи по этой проблеме?
>:]
как вариант
Как вариант после сборки нового ядра не был прописан симлинк в /usr/src/linux, он и поныне указывавет на сорцы старого ядра. Соответственно дрова nvidia не собираются.
Пропиши симлинк, пересобери nvidia-drivers.
Да пребудет с тобой великий Linux.
Сейчас перешел на ядро
Сейчас перешел на ядро vanilla-sources-2.6.29.2 как и было и все заработало!
Наверно что-нибудь с genpatches что nvidia-drivers не работают :-/
>:]
Вообще вряд ли. Конфиги
Вообще вряд ли. Конфиги одинаковые, через oldconfig прогнанные?
Текстовый редактор vi имеет два режима работы: в первом он пищит, а во втором — всё портит.
У меня было ядро
У меня было ядро vanilla-sources-2.6.29.2
Решил поставить gentoo-sources-2.6.29-r4.
Конфиг делал так: zcat /proc/config.gz > /usr/src/linux/.config
>:]
А make oldconfig? Это было
А make oldconfig? Это было недостаточно, конфиги у них не одинаковы.
Текстовый редактор vi имеет два режима работы: в первом он пищит, а во втором — всё портит.
Спасибо за информацию! Я
Спасибо за информацию! Я этого не знал :(
>:]